Understanding Water Heater Types

When choosing a new water heater, it’s essential to understand your options. Traditional storage water heaters, or tank heaters, are popular and budget-friendly. They heat water in a tank using electricity or gas and are easy to install.

For greater efficiency, consider tankless water heaters, which heat water on demand without a storage tank. This eliminates standby energy loss and is ideal for energy-conscious households. Solar water heaters use solar panels to harness the sun’s energy, which is eco-friendly but requires a higher initial investment and good sunlight exposure. Heat pump water heaters are another efficient choice; they use air heat to warm water and perform well in various climates.

Determining the Right Size and Capacity

Choosing the right size for your water heater is critical to ensure it meets your household’s hot water needs without wasting energy. Tank water heaters offer a range of capacities, typically from 20 to 80 gallons. The rule of thumb is to account for about 10 to 15 gallons of water per person in your household. For tankless water heaters, the focus shifts to the flow rate, measured in gallons per minute, which should be chosen based on simultaneous usage expectations.

Fuel Type and Energy Efficiency

Common fuels for water heaters include electricity, natural gas, and solar energy. Gas water heaters generally offer faster recovery rates and lower operating costs, particularly relevant in areas with high electricity rates. However, electric models can be more convenient and cheaper to install, depending on your home’s existing infrastructure.

Energy efficiency is another paramount concern. Models with higher energy efficiency ratings may cost more upfront but can lead to significant savings on your utility bills over time. Look for models with ENERGY STAR® certification, which indicates superior efficiency and performance.

Maintenance and Longevity

Maintenance considerations should not be overlooked. Traditional storage tanks require regular flushing to remove sediment buildup, while tankless models may need periodic cleaning to prevent scale buildup and maintain efficiency. Solar water heaters might necessitate the cleaning of collector panels. Opting for a model that matches your willingness and ability to perform regular maintenance can influence the unit’s longevity and operational efficiency.

Understanding the Total Cost

The initial purchase price of water heaters can be deceiving, but make sure to consider not only the installation cost but also the operating expenses and any potential energy savings over time. While traditional storage water heaters might have lower upfront costs, tankless, solar, and heat pump models may offer lower long-term operating expenses due to their increased energy efficiency.
